Industry Standards

In the world of facility management, we look to the Council of Educational Facility Planners International (CEFPI) for guidance. As a rule of thumb, experts suggest that while you can fit a student into 15 square feet, you should aim for 25 to 35 for optimal learning.

Tool Accuracy Explained

Accuracy is my top priority. In the USA, building codes like the NFPA 101 dictate that classrooms usually require 20 net square feet per person. Our tool uses these exact parameters. However, I always tell my clients that "code capacity" and "comfort capacity" are different. Our tool gives you the flexibility to toggle between "Maximum Density" and "Optimal Learning Environment" to ensure your students aren't packed like sardines.

The "Facility Lab" Verdict

In 2026, the "Golden Rule" for Dojang capacity is based on the Strike Radius. For Taekwondo, where high kicks are frequent, each student effectively occupies a circular "safety zone" with a 3-foot radius from their center point. Our calculator accounts for these overlapping radii to ensure that even during intensive spinning drills, your students remain safe and focused.
